The spokesperson for the Popular Party in the Catalan Parliament, Juan Fernández, demanded the immediate closure of the Sant Adrià de Besòs CAS center on Tuesday, January 6, citing its irresponsible location near a school.

The spokesperson for the Popular Party in the Catalan Parliament, Juan Fernández, described the current location of the Drug Addiction Care and Monitoring Center (CAS) as “irresponsibility” and “negligence.” The party urges the Government of Catalonia to move the center to an alternative location.

"They are using the La Mina neighborhood as a television set to announce millions in funding and mask the harsh reality that residents are experiencing."

Juan Fernández · Popular Party Spokesperson in Parliament
In a statement, Fernández directly criticized the President of the Generalitat, Salvador Illa, and the Mayor of Sant Adrià, Filo Cañete. He accused them of failing to address the real problems affecting residents.
According to the PP, the current location of the CAS “normalizes high-risk behavior” and forces minors to physically coexist with drug consumption. This situation, the party argues, generates a negative impact on the environment and the perception of safety in the neighborhood.
